Modelsim for mac altera stock

Consult the release notes and installation notes that came with your software package for more information. Modelsim pe student edition is not be used for business use or evaluation. Introduction to dsp builder, dsp builder handbook, volume 1. Later, we are going to use modelsim to simulate our project. Set up a project with the modelsimaltera software if your design contains the altgxb megafunction, to map to the precompiled stratix gx functional simulation model. Dsp builder uses the quartus ii libraries to share functionality that exists in the. Virtualbox is available for windows, linux and mac os. What to use for vhdldigitallogic simulation on mac os x. About this ip core the 10gbps ethernet 10gbe media access controller mac ip core is a configurable component that implements the ieee 802. The complete download includes all available device families. Simulate with modelsim modelsim simulation software modelsim can be used to simulate vhdlcode, to determine whether it is right thinking. More than a tutorial a demo quartus ii modelsim modelsim ece232 alteramodelsimtutorial design an 8 bit cla adder delay computation for p iandgiandci p. Things i already did the verilog files that are created in the project for the pll doesnt seem to have any effect, when i add it to the modelsim and compile.

So we need to tell quartus to generate the files needed by modelsim. Modelsimaltera starter edition is a free program that offers you support for simulating small fpga designs. The combined files download for the quartus ii design software includes a number of additional software components. Some people are reporting that following the steps for them does not fix the problem. Unfortunately, there is no official version of modelsim for mac available on the market, so you will have to use other programs that can do this job.

Modelsim by altera corporation is a wellknown hdl simulation tool for vhdl, verilog and systemc languages. The verification community is eager to answer your uvm, systemverilog and coverage related questions. You are ready to use modelsim to perform the testbench simulations, but first you need to compile your design files in modelsim 1. This tutorial is for use with the altera denano boards. Modelsim pe student edition is intended for use by students in pursuit of their academic coursework and basic educational projects. You have to add the library to modelsims search path. The altera version of modelsim is also integrated with a database with facts about altera chips, eg. We encourage you to take an active role in the forums by answering and commenting to any questions that you are able to. Modelsimaltera edition download free version modelsim. Modelsimaltera starter edition, platform, file name, size.

Under eda netlist writer settings, in the format for output netlist list, select. The modelsimintel fpga edition software is a version of the modelsim software targeted for intel fpgas devices. Apr 10, 2020 the modelsim altera edition software is licensed to support designs written in 100 percent vhdl and 100 percent verilog language and does not support designs that are written in a combination of vhdl and verilog language, also known as mixed hdl. Electronics quartus ii installing modelsimaltera starter. Modelsim is only a functional verification tool so you will also have to use quartus ii to complete timing analysis on your design before you can be sure it will work the de2 hardware. Altera quartus ii software allows the user to launch modelsimaltera simulator from within the software using the quartus ii feature called nativelink. Before you read this tutorial, setup your system to use the modelsim ase 6. There is a howto in altaras documentation on setting up the libraries for simulation in modelsim.

It is divided into fourtopics, which you will learn more about in subsequent. Ethernet ping test using telnet from pc to the max 10. The modelsim altera starter edition is a program for use in the simulation of small fieldprogrammable gate arrays. The program allows you to create your own designs or choose from a vast library of. Creating testbench using modelsim altera wave editor you can use modelsim altera wave editor to draw your test input waveforms and generate a verilog hdl or vhdl testbench. Any native mac os x environments for getting started with vhdl. Document last updated for altera complete design suite version. The following sections cover how to install the simulator, to set the path to the simulator, and to set the simulator for your design. This comprehensive chapter from the quartus prime development software handbook provides stepbystep instructions for performing functional register transfer level rtl, functional postsynthesis, or postfitting timing simulations with the modelsimaltera and modelsim simulators. After youve downloaded crossover check out our youtube tutorial video to the left, or visit the crossover chrome os walkthrough for specific steps. Creating and simulating memories in maxplus2 and modelsim. Perform a functional simulation with the modelsimaltera.

Proper functional and timing simulation is important to ensure design. Consult the release notes and installation notes that came. Creating testbench using modelsimaltera wave editor. Modelsim can be used independently, or in conjunction with intel quartus prime, xilinx ise or xilinx vivado. Modelsimaltera edition intel software online catalog. Quartus and modelsim altera error fix engineer tips. You can see the altera libraries in the modelsim altera starter edition free below. It facilitates the process of simulation by providing an easy to use mechanism and precompiled libraries for simulation objective. Modelsim is a multilanguage hdl simulation environment by mentor graphics, for simulation of hardware description languages such as vhdl, verilog and systemc, and includes a builtin c debugger. It is the free version of the modelsim software from altera and thus has restrictions on its use. Modelsim altera starter edition 10,000 lines of code limit.

Ensc 350 modelsim altera tutorial this is a quick guide get you started with the modelsim altera simulator. Do not check the run gatelevel simulation automatically after compilation box. To achieve a smaller download and installation footprint, you can select device support in the. Modelsim tutorial university of california, san diego. Altera edition has no line limitations and altera starter edition has 10,000 executable line. Are there any native mac os x environments for getting started with vhdl fpgas. Ghdl is an opensource simulator for the vhdl language. For more complex projects, universities and colleges have access to modelsim and questa, through the higher education program.

Creating and simulating memories in maxplus2 and modelsim author. A list of files included in each download can be viewed in the tool tip i icon to the right of the description. Ensure that run gatelevel simulation automatically after compilation box is turned off. Creating testbench using modelsimaltera wave editor you can use modelsimaltera wave editor to draw your test input waveforms and generate a verilog hdl or vhdl testbench. Modelsim altera starter edition service packs for v5. Then you simply compile all the modules into a library, including the altera quartus generated wrapper for the pll, the wrapper should then have references to the available altera libraries with the. Modelsimaltera software support intel fpga and soc. One calls that eda for electronic design automation its like a debugger for a software program. Combined with a guibased wave viewer and a good vhdl text editor, ghdl is a very powerful tool for writing, testing and simulating your vhdl code.

Compilation in modelsimaltera now that you have created and compiled the project in quartus ii. Xilinx ise software provides an integrated flow with the model technology modelsim simulator, which allows you to run simulation from the xilinx project navigator. To achieve a smaller download and installation footprint, you can select device support in the multiple. Cant launch the modelsimaltera software the path to the location of the executables for the modelsimaltera software were not specified or. The most popular versions among the software users are 14. The software supports intel gatelevel libraries and includes behavioral simulation, hdl test benches, and tcl scripting. Modelsim can be used independently, or in conjunction with intel quartus prime, xilinx ise or.

Ghdl allows you to compile and execute your vhdl code directly in your pc. The following sections cover how to install modelsim, to set the path to the modelsim simulator, and to set modelsim as the simulator for your design. Modelsimaltera starter edition free download windows. Modelsim apears in two editions altera edition and altera starter edition. Tricking your mac in to believing it can run modelsim sigasi. You can then perform an rtl or gatelevel simulation to verify the correctness of your design. Browse digikeys inventory of modelsim altera editionsoftware. Start a new quartus project using the project wizard and choose sums as the name of design and top module. Go to assignments settings and select modelsim altera in the tool name field. Popular alternatives to modelsim for windows, linux, web, software as a service saas, mac and more. This video demonstrates using the max10 fpga development kit running a triplespeed ethernet design to verify the phy autonegotiation process, check the. I am working on trying to find out what the issue is. Modelsim xemodelsim xilinx edition iii mxe iii is the xilinx version of modelsim which is based on modelsim pe. Modelsim is a program recommended for simulating all fpga designs cyclone, arria, and stratix series fpga designs.

Modelsimaltera starter edition free download windows version. If you are loading an old project and compiled all files and. The modelsimaltera starter edition is a program for use in the simulation of small fieldprogrammable gate arrays. Modelsim click the download free trial button above and get a 14day, fullyfunctional trial of crossover. Next, we will create a fake modelsim installation dir on the mac. Modelsimaltera edition software is licensed to support designs written in 100 percent vhdl and 100. Any native mac os x environments for getting started with.

The leds labelled led1, led2 and led3 will be the outputs. Maxchips, so one can also do simulations that take into account the time delay. Modelsim has a 33 percent faster simulation performance than modelsim altera starter edition. Explore 7 apps like modelsim, all suggested and ranked by the alternativeto user community. Features, specifications, alternative product, product training modules, and datasheets are all available. The license validation routine looks for your mac address on device eth0. I suddenly realized that there is no altera quartus or xilins ise or modelsim on mac os x. Using the modelsim software with the quartus ii software. Changed the order of the compilation in the modelsim, still no positive response.

Compilation in modelsim altera now that you have created and compiled the project in quartus ii. Modelsimaltera software simulation user guide january 20 altera corporation 1. What to use for vhdldigitallogic simulation on mac os x stack. Intel fpga simulation with modelsimintel fpga software supports behavioral and gatelevel simulations, including vhdl or verilog test benches.

The values will change each time button1 is pushed. The two differences between modelsim altera starter edition and modelsim altera edition are that simulation performance are best with msae and with the msse you cannot compile more than 10,000 lines of code. There is an example tcl script for this at modelsim tcl scripting examples under library setup script vhdl. The combined files download for the quartus prime design software includes a number of additional software components. Trying to get a version of modelsim running on a very modern version of linux often presents challenges. Modelsimaltera edition included with quartus prime standard edition. Im trying to simulate functional test a project that contains both my own codes and some instances of altera floating point ip core generated using megawizard on modelsim.

295 1465 1041 999 416 425 660 1649 624 1597 298 477 341 870 189 1311 933 1181 662 1592 1175 1451 59 851 796 1368 1175 1498 862 30 1433 587 1246 236 1415 351 1175 449 517 20 1001 1166 571 681 1168 769 387 1096